How are you searching your Mac for keywords? Are you using the search field or are you using a smart album? I am getting very different results when using a smart album compared to the search field. A smart album, for example with the rule "keyword is ..." is showing all photos with the keyword, and only the photos with the keyword, showing the indexing is correct, while the search field is showing a selection of items related to the search string. To see, if the indexing is correct, you may want to test with a smart album.
- The smart album "Keyword is Bird" is finding 3038 photos and 13 videos.

- The search for "Bird" is given mixed results - 3059 items including photos with any metadata with "Bird" as a text:

Photos for Mac used to have a specific search result labelled "keyword", that is gone now in macOS 26 Tahoe.
Searching on my iPhone 15 Pro Max for "Bird" ais giving nearly the same result - the differences might be explained by the iCloud syncing, that has been paused. 
The iPhone is still including the keywords in the results for a text search, even if it is not showing the keywords. but the search on the Mac is now as limited as in the iPhone; I am very glad the Mac is still supporting keywords in the smart albums.
